Child Advocacy and Protection Program (CAPP) Advanced Practice Provider
Dartmouth Health Children’s and Geisel School of Medicine

The Department of Pediatrics at Dartmouth Health Children’s and The Geisel School of Medicine at Dartmouth seeks a certified Advanced Practice Provider to join its medical staff. This individual will provide acute and non-acute medical assessments, treatment recommendations, and team communication for children and adolescents when there are questions about any type of child maltreatment. Requirements include training and experience in the care of children and adolescents. Experience in Child Abuse Pediatrics is preferred but not required, as training will be provided by CAPP.

Dartmouth Health Children’s provides an extended system of care with primary, specialty, and advanced tertiary pediatric services, including an inpatient pediatric unit with PICU, level II Pediatric Trauma Center, and level III NICU at its flagship Children’s Hospital at Dartmouth Hitchcock Medical Center (CHaD). Dartmouth Health Children’s also operates a comprehensive ambulatory specialty center at the Dartmouth Hitchcock Clinic in Manchester, the largest city in the state, and 10 pediatric primary care medical homes across the region. Dartmouth Health Children’s is committed to addressing racism and other forms of oppression that prevent all children and adolescents from living their healthiest, happiest lives.

CAPP provides a full range of multidisciplinary inpatient and outpatient consultations at DHMC in Lebanon and D-H clinics in Manchester and Nashua It also serves as an important resource for a variety of clinicians, community professionals, and Child Advocacy Centers throughout New Hampshire, Vermont, and Maine. This position will be based primarily at the Manchester clinic.

An essential component of this position will be working with the CAPP Director to help educate medical students, residents, sexual assault nurse examiners, and other health care professionals on the extensive needs of this vulnerable population. Academic appointment at The Geisel School of Medicine is therefore required, at a rank commensurate with academic portfolio.

Dartmouth Health Children’s is the pediatric service of Dartmouth Health, an integrated academic healthcare delivery system for northern New England anchored by Dartmouth Hitchcock Medical Center (DHMC) in Lebanon, New Hampshire. DHMC is recognized by US News & World Report as the Best Hospital in NH and is home to over 50 graduate medical education programs, NHs only Level 1 Trauma Center and air ambulance service, the Dartmouth Cancer Center (a National Cancer Institute designated comprehensive cancer center), and CHaD.
